The Digital Photography course at Warren G. Harding serves as an introduction to the various disciplines of modern photography.  The course offers an opportunity to learn and manipulate the hard skills of modern technologies linked with conceptual skills required to create sound artistic composition.  The students concentrate on the tools of the trade; the anatomy of the camera and proper settings for use, through the survey of Adobe Photoshop for editing and artistic manipulation.  This course concentrates on the different genre of photography such as portraiture, landscape, urban, commercial, and abstract.
